Ally McCoist believes Mo Salah should have vented his fury with Jurgen Klopp in the dressing room and not on the touchline after their quarrel at West Ham.
He also offered his advice to Salah and Liverpool in how they should sort his future, while Peter Crouch sympathised with how he would be 'fuming' for being dropped.
Salah had a heated touchline exchange with his manager during Liverpool's 2-2 draw when Klopp tried to bring him on as a late substitute.
He waved his arms around, pointing at the pitch and Klopp, and only stopped berating him when Darwin Nunez, who had also been dropped, stepped in.
Klopp refused to shed light on the spat but said they had spoken about it, while Salah issued an explosive warning: 'If I speak, there will be fire.'
